You'd have to modify it to make it symmetrical like that, but look at the air filter from the 2003+ Chevrolet Express van with V8 (any size).
About a 5.25" x 13" cylinder with an 85mm opening in the foam-rubber base that will stretch tight over a 3.5" pipe.
It has more than enough flow area and they are cheap and always going to be in stock at your auto store if you need it.
I'm building an airbox for one right now, for my SC-944.
